Default Dovetail sight users...

Do you always max out the possible length of your sight? Why or why not and please explain thought process of your method. Thanks

Default RE: Dovetail sight users...

It really depends on what size peep I am using.

If it is a small peep then I have the sight bar out as far as it needs to be so I can center the sight ring in the peep.

If the peep has a large hole then the sight is slid in towards the riser till the sight ring centers in the peep.

Default RE: Dovetail sight users...

I max out the length of mine, reasoning is because I want the pins as far away from as possible so it makes them as small as possible. When picking out a spot, I want to be able to pick out the smallest spot possible. Aim small, miss small.

Default RE: Dovetail sight users...

I have mine all the way out as well. You get a finer aiming point, clearer pins, and the sight housing lines up better w/ my peep. It has most definetly improved my shooting.
